Not this
He made debut as a singer.
Use this
He made a debut as a singer.
在英语中,debut 是可数名词,前面需要加冠词 a 或 the。中文里“初次登台”是名词短语,但不需要冠词,所以容易遗漏。
Not this
She made her debut in the stage.
Use this
She made her debut on the stage.
表示“在舞台上首次登台”,英语用介词 on,而中文用“在...上”,容易误用 in。

语域:neutral 常见场景:演艺界、体育赛事、社交场合 该词通常为中性语体,正式与非正式场合均可使用,多用于描述表演、体育或社交活动中的首次公开亮相。
通常用作可数名词,常与不定冠词连用。
